Luke Skywalker’s Medal of Yavin sells for nearly $400K, Chewbacca’s bowcaster goes for $768K

There’s no approach to put a worth on the Battle of Yavin — an occasion that modified the course of historical past in “Star Wars.” However a medal given to the heroes of that key Insurrection win was bought for nearly $400,000 at a current public sale.

A prop medal given to Luke Skywalker (Mark Hamill) within the authentic “Star Wars” movie bought for $378,000 on Wednesday, the primary day of Propstore’s Leisure Memorabilia Stay Public sale. The three-day occasion, which concluded Friday, boasted memorabilia from movies together with “Ghostbusters,” “Batman Returns,” “Jurassic Park,” “Conan the Barbarian” and “Tron” in addition to the TV reveals “Star Trek: The Original Series,” “Battlestar Galactica,” “Breaking Bad” and “Friends.”

Along with the Medal of Yavin — a medal of bravery of types bestowed by Princess Leia on Skywalker and Han Solo for his or her roles in serving to destroy the Dying Star — the public sale additionally featured Chewbacca’s bowcaster. The prop of the Wookiee’s crossbow-like laser blaster fetched $768,600 throughout the public sale.

Luke Skywalker’s Medal of Yavin from “Star Wars.”

(Propstore)

The Battle of Yavin, the primary key win for the Insurgent Alliance in opposition to the Empire, is the occasion that separates time intervals within the galaxy far, far-off. The years earlier than that battle are labeled BBY, for Earlier than the Battle of Yavin, whereas the years after are labeled ABY, for After the Battle of Yavin. The upcoming second season of Disney+’ “Andor” will span 4 to 1 BBY.

Props from the “Star Wars” franchise weren’t the one ones that bought large final week. Different notable gross sales throughout the public sale, in response to Propstore, included a radio-controlled light-up ghost entice from “Ghostbusters” and “Ghostbusters II,” which went for $327,600. Within the movie, the entice was triggered by a pedal and was one of many instruments utilized by the paranormal investigators to seize numerous spirits haunting New York.

A pedal connected to a small metal box.

A prop of the ghost entice from “Ghostbusters.”

(Propstore)

Additionally among the many gadgets featured within the public sale had been Conan’s sword from “Conan the Barbarian,” which fetched $176,400; a Batsuit from “Batman Returns,” which went for $157,500; Dumbledore’s wand from “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ire,” which bought for $94,500; and Wolverine’s claws from “X-Men: The Last Stand,” which netted $20,160.

Pee-wee Herman’s iconic crimson bicycle from Tim Burton’s “Pee-wee’s Big Adventure,” which was anticipated to draw bids within the $15,000 to $30,000 vary, finally bought for $144,900.
